Morning all, hoping for some assistance!
Backgroud:
After 100,000 miles servicing, we have parted with the local (friends) garage, on mutual grounds and under a bit of a dark cloud. Early last year ago my wife's '89 320i convertible was booked in for an MOT and she was told it was time also for a cam belt and a coolant pump.
It turns out the business owner was retiring, and the friendly banter of the day was he was starting to forget things. There were two items initially to notice. The bonnet hinges had not been tightened and it ended its travel first time opening mostly up, but at a 45° angle from vertical. Second thing there was no new water pump, this put the cam belt in question, there was nothing entered in the service book and the paid-for invoice at this point was not forthcoming.
Moving on......arriving home one day a few weeks later the car engine had a light knocking sound.
This could now be any manner of things. 50 years ago I was capable of dismantling a Triumph Stag and a VW Beetle, but nowadays who knows? I started on the assumption the wife had filled up with some lower octane fuel, but pumping it all out and replacing it with the best was no answer. The months following I've cleaned and checked everything including another cam belt, new water pump, sonic clean injectors, tappets, tappets, tappets, plugs oil twice.
The last thing (I hope) is the AFM. Over 200,000 miles the AFM has not been touched, until that last visit to the MOT. The black plastic 'cap' was GLUED -on so it took two days to release, (now a little damaged) and there is no longer a red cover to the un-measured air supply for idling. The number 15.9 was still hidden/smothered in the yellow anti-rust chromate coating.
I am now stuck having no way to know what abuse might have violated the 'never open' secrets of the air/petrol/granary mix that goes for fuel. I have read loads of internet stuff trying to find out the following please help if you can with:

I have a video I seem unable to upload, so have put in an image (can send a video separately if anyone 5inks they can help) of the corrugated potentiometer:
A. What do the white numbes signify?
Is a '1' number a 1.6 litre car, and '500' number a 3.0litre car with other engine sizes between and beyond into 5 series? Are they the mileage ? Impossible without taking off the cap.

B. The video shows a still-knocking COLD engine at idle which (take my word) is 760rpm. The potentiometer slider is around 40° rev range the secret bypass air is adding itself, and the idle valve is also adding its' ha'pennyworth. Seems a heck of a lot of air for 'idle'.

C. Turning back time to October 1989 with a completed car ready to drive out into the car park how did the tech -team know which number to start on before they fine tuned the sprockets and checked the exhaust emissions before they punched in the tiny 15.9 numbers.

D Does anyone in the UK know how to do this? BMW Swindon offer to service E30's of any age, but when asked direct they don't do this part of a service any more.

Thank you in advance for any and all advice!

I would suggest checking some basics such as tappet/rocker clearances and leaks around the inlet manifold and vacuum hoses before attempting to adjust the AFM. Also, remove the spark plugs and check they are gapped properly and showing the correct mixture colour (biscuit/light tan).
